Expression Of Melanoma-associated Antigen -A3 And- A9 In Cervical Lesions And Its Clinical Significance

Objectives:The expression of MAGE-A3,MAGE-A9 protein and gene was detected by histopathological abnormalities in cervical lesions and compared with normal tissues.To study the relationship between MAGE-A3 and MAGE-A9 and the development and development of cervical intraepithelial neoplasia and cervical cancer,so as to provide a theoretical basis for the diagnosis and treatment of cervical lesions,and then to develop a practical treatment program.Methods:(CIN ?)40 cases,cervical cancer Ia ~ b period(FIGO staging)60 cases,cervical cancer IIa period(FIGO staging)24 cases,cervical intraepithelial neoplasia(CIN ?)Normal cervix in 40 cases.All patients underwent surgical treatment,access to patient data,combined with the patient's clinical and pathological data for analysis.The expression of MAGE-A3 and MAGE-A9 was observed under light microscope.The expression of MAGE-A3 and MAGE-A9 was observed by immunohistochemical staining.The expression of MAGE-A3 and MAGE-A9 gene in 15 cases of normal cervical,15 cases of CIN? and 20 cases of cervical cancer were detected by real-time fluorescent PCR.Happening.The expression of MAGE-A3 and MAGE-A9 protein in 15 cases of normal cervical,15 cases of CIN? and 20 cases of cervical cancer were detected by Western Blot.Result: 1.Immunohistochemistry showed that MAGE-A3 protein was positive in cervical cancer and cervical intraepithelial neoplasia,mainly located on the cytoplasm,and the expression level of MAGE-A3 protein increased gradually with the severity of cervical lesions.The positive expression rates of MAGE-A3 in normal cervix,CIN? and cervical cancer were 5.00%,15.00% and 48.81% respectively,and the positive expression of MAGE-A3 was gradually increased.The statistical analysis showed that the normal group and CIN? group(P <0.01).On the contrary,there was no significant difference between the normal group and the CIN? group(P> 0.05).The results showed that the expression of MAGE-A3 was significantly higher than that of the normal group(P <0.01)The expression level of MAGE-A3 was correlated with the clinical stage,pathological grade,lymphatic metastasis and HPV infection of cervical cancer(P <0.05).MAGE-A9 protein was positive in cervical cancer and CIN tissues.The positive expression rates of MAGE-A9 in normal cervical,CIN? and cervical cancer tissues were 7.50%,17.50% and 55.95% respectively,and the positive expression of MAGE-A9(P <0.01).Compared with CIN ? group,the expression of MAGE-A9 in normal group and CIN ? group was significantly higher than that in CIN ? group(P <0.01).(P <0.05).The results showed that the expression level of MAGE-A9 was correlated with the clinical stage,pathological grade and lymphatic metastasis of cervical cancer(p <0.05).2.Real-time quantitative PCR showed that:(1)The relative expression levels of MAGE-A3 mRNA in normal cervix,CIN? and cervical cancer tissues were 0.184 ± 0.069,0.221 ± 0.086 and 0.702 ± 0.145 respectively with GAPDH mRNA as reference standard.The relative expression of MAGE-A3 mRNA in cervical cancer was significantly higher than that in CIN and normal tissues.There was significant difference between cervical cancer group and normal group and CIN? group(P <0.05),but there was significant difference between normal group and CIN ? group No statistically significant(P> 0.05)(2)GAPDH mRNA as the internal reference standard,normal cervical,CIN? and cervical cancerThe expression level of MAGE-A9 mRNA in cervical cancer tissues was significantly higher than that in CIN and normal tissues,and the relative expression levels of MAGE-A9 mRNA were 0.182 ± 0.062,0.234 ± 0.087 and 0.642 ± 0.150 respectively.(P <0.05),but there was no significant difference between the normal group and CIN? group(P> 0.05),but there was no significant difference between the two groups(P> 0.05)3.Western bloting protein blotting shows:(1)The gray level of MAGE-A3 gradually increased with the severity of cervical tissue lesions.The relative expression levels of MAGE-A3 protein in normal cervix,CIN? and cervical cancer tissues were 0.943±0.178?1.035±0.139?1.977±0.105 respectively.The relative expression of MAGE-A9 protein in cervical cancer tissues was significantly higher than that in CIN? and normal cervical tissues(P <0.05),but there was no significant difference between normal group and CIN ? group(P> 0.05).(2)The gray level of MAGE-A9 gradually increased with the severity of cervical lesions,and the relative expression levels of MAGE-A9 protein in normal cervical,CIN and cervical cancer tissues were 0.857 ± 0.315,0.909 ± 0.526,1.882 ± 0.179,respectively.The relative expression of MAGE-A9 protein in cervical cancer tissues was significantly higher than that in CIN? and normal cervical tissues(P <0.05),but there was no significant difference between normal group and CIN ? group(P> 0.05).Conclusion:1.MAGE-A3 overexpression is closely related to the development of cervical cancer,and the overexpression of MAGE-A3 is closely related to the clinical stage,pathological grade and lymphatic metastasis and high-risk HPV infection of cervical cancer,but not with age and cancer type Obviously,MAGE-A3 may be an important tumor marker for the early diagnosis of cervical disease and the treatment of cervical cancer.MAGE-A3 may be an ideal target for the biological treatment of cervical cancer,which is of great clinical value for further understanding the prognosis of cervical cancer biological behavior.2.The overexpression of MAGE-A9 is closely related to the development of cervical cancer.The overexpression of MAGE-A9 is related to the clinical stage,pathological grade and lymphatic metastasis of cervical cancer.MAGE-A9 may be an early diagnosis of cervical disease,An important tumor marker for cervical cancer treatment.MAGE-A9 may be the ideal target for the biological treatment of cervical cancer.MAGE-A9 has a great clinical value for further understanding the prognosis of cervical cancer biological behavior.
